shell基础——循环
语法:
for i in 1 2 3 4 do command done for ((var=1 ; var<6 ; var++)) do command done for ((var=5 ; var>0 ;var--)) do command done for i in $(seq 100) #产生1到100的序列 do command done for i in $(seq 1 2 100) #从1到100,步长2 for i in {50..100} for i in {50..100..2} for i in {100..50..-2} for ((i=50 ;i<101 ; i+=2)) for i in $(ls)
while [条件] do command done while true #死循环
continue ——重新开始循环 break ——跳出循环 exit ——直接跳出程序
exit 10 ——退出程序并返回10

浙公网安备 33010602011771号